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Bodmin Parkway to Fernhill start from as little as £25.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Bodmin Parkway Train Station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a pleasant travel experience. The ticket office operates from 7:00 AM to 6: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 10:35 AM to 6:00 PM on Sundays, allowing travelers to purchase and collect tickets with ease. The station features ticket machines, including accessible options, alongside induction loops to aid communication for those with hearing difficulties.

For commuters with specific needs, Bodmin Parkway offers step-free access, but please note that full accessibility is only available on the Penzance-bound platform. While accessible toilets are unavailable, basic toilet facilities, complete with baby-changing areas, are situated on Platform 1.

Getting To and From the Station

Connecting with other transport modes is hassle-free at Bodmin Parkway. Taxis are stationed at the entrance, providing convenient onward travel solutions. For those preferring bus services, the stops are conveniently located in the station car park. When planning your journey, remember to review transportation links to prominent airports via Reading and Bristol Temple Meads for Heathrow and Gatwick services.

A Few Additional Tips

If you’re planning on cycling to the station, you’ll find bicycle stands available, though the absence of shelter means you'll need to keep an eye on the weather. For those driving, the station offers 95 parking spaces, including five designated for accessible parking. While the car park doesn't feature CCTV, parking fees are quite reasonable, with daily charges set at £5.00 and a special rate of £3.50 on weekends.

Station Facilities and Amenities

One of the main aspects of Fernhill station is its simplicity. The station operates without a ticket office or ticket machines, meaning you'll need to purchase your tickets online or through mobile apps before arrival. This station supports smartcard validation but does not issue them. Assistance is readily available through helplines and accessible contact points, although there are no customer help points within the station.

While there are no waiting rooms or lounges to pass the time, a dedicated seating area ensures comfort while you await your train. There’s no Wi-Fi or refreshment facilities on-site, and although there’s step-free access throughout the station, you'll find no accessible toilets or nearby parking facilities.

Travel Connections at Your Fingertips

If you're considering ongoing journeys, Fernhill makes it manageable with its transport links, albeit limited. The rail replacement bus stop can be found close by on Aberdare Road, facilitating transitions during railway disruptions. Unfortunately, there are no direct cycling facilities or hire options, so cycle aficionados should plan accordingly.
